This book tells the tale of Richard Whitney and describes in detail the banking and investment structure that precipitated the stock market collapse of 1929, and how as president of the New York Stock Exchange, Richard Whitney played his role while manipulating powerful and trusted friends. This is both a biography of an important figure and an excellent primer on the reasons for securities regulations that are in today's headlines.
